The owner of Partouche International, Patrick Partouche, was fined 40,000 euros and handed a 12 month suspended sentence by the French court for his participation in an online gambling company which illegally targeted French players, and his company was ordered to pay 150,000 for lending its name to the website "Casino770.com" and "Poker770.com".
